Mumbai: Bandra-Khar to get new Rs 36-cr ROB

<p>Existing 35-year-old ROB will be pulled down; project is part of the multi-crore plan to add two more rail lines &mdash; fifth and sixth &mdash; between Borivli and Mumbai Central to facilitate long-distance trains</p>

Listen to this article :

In an attempt to improve the efficiency of its suburban services, the Western Railway (WR) has planned to demolish the existing Rail Over Bridge (ROB) between Khar and Bandra.

The existing bridge will be demolished only after the ROB is commissioned, claimed WR authorities. Pic/Nimesh Dave
